WOC – Every action in which we indulge first takes place in our minds as a thought or an idea. As children of God, we must try to keep our minds focused on the kingdom of heaven. Thoughts that are filled with the things of God are what keep us at peace on a daily basis. The mind can easily become a battle zone when we allow negative thoughts and untimely desires to take residence. The Bible says be anxious for nothing, but in everything by prayer and supplication, with thanksgiving, let our requests be made know to God; and the peace of God, which surpasses all understanding, will guard our hearts and minds through Christ Jesus (Phil 4:6,7). The word anxious can be used to mean “worried.” We are exhorted in this passage not to worry about anything, but to give it over to God through prayer and faith. It can be challenging to think consistently on the things of Christ for long periods of time when turmoil is going on around us and within us. The question is, do we have any power over the situations? Probably not, because if we did, we would have already changed the situations. Stay encouraged and focused on Christ. He is our answer to every question and dilemma that arises in our life. Lord thank you for leading and protecting us today and every day. Thank you for changing the atmosphere of our lives.
